This 3-bed, 2-bath home, designed by renowned architect Hugh Taylor, showcases mid-century modern elegance in the historic Paradise Palms neighborhood. Built in the 1960s on a 9,583 sq ft lot, it has been meticulously restored to preserve its retro charm while incorporating modern updates. Features include stained concrete floors, a wood-burning fireplace, a breezeway block wall, and expansive floor-to-ceiling windows that flood the home with natural light. The open floor plan is perfect for entertaining, flowing seamlessly to a private backyard with a sparkling saltwater pool and modern desert landscaping. A two-car carport adds convenience. Located in a historically rich, no-HOA community, Paradise Palms offers a close-knit atmosphere with monthly socials and events. The Paradise Palms community is just two miles east of the Las Vegas Strip. Known for its uniquely designed mid-century modern tract homes, Paradise Palms has a rich history of celebrity residents (name dropping: Debbie Reynolds and late-night legend Johnny Carson) as well as cool apartment homes.
Several Paradise Palms homes and apartments are in walking distance of the Las Vegas National Golf Course, the Boulevard Mall, and the Seaquest Las Vegas aquarium. Residents are just minutes from the Pecos-McLeod hiking trail, restaurants on East Desert Inn Road, and Sunrise Hospital.
